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ente Prochaine révision | Révision précédente Prochaine révisionLes deux révisions suivantes | ||
materiels:afficheurs:ard0_96 [2023/08/21 09:00] – [0,96" 128x64 OLED 2864 Display module - SSD1306 (I2C)] phil | materiels:afficheurs:ard0_96 [2024/01/24 07:07] – [2. Programmation] phil | ||
---|---|---|---|
Ligne 2: | Ligne 2: | ||
===== 0,96" 128x64 OLED 2864 Display module - SSD1306 (I2C) ===== | ===== 0,96" 128x64 OLED 2864 Display module - SSD1306 (I2C) ===== | ||
- | [Mise à jour le 20/8/2023] | + | [Mise à jour le 21/8/2023] |
{{ : | {{ : | ||
Ligne 25: | Ligne 25: | ||
La technologie OLED est utilisée dans des applications commerciales telles que les écrans pour téléphones mobiles et lecteurs multimédias portables, les autoradios et les appareils photo numériques, | La technologie OLED est utilisée dans des applications commerciales telles que les écrans pour téléphones mobiles et lecteurs multimédias portables, les autoradios et les appareils photo numériques, | ||
\\ | \\ | ||
- | L' | + | L' |
* **Caractéristiques** | * **Caractéristiques** | ||
Ligne 36: | Ligne 36: | ||
* **Tension d' | * **Tension d' | ||
* **Consommation maximale** : 20mA @ 3v | * **Consommation maximale** : 20mA @ 3v | ||
+ | * **Angle de vision: >160°** | ||
* **Dimensions** : 41.2x26.2x8mm | * **Dimensions** : 41.2x26.2x8mm | ||
Ligne 44: | Ligne 45: | ||
* **x** : position du point par rapport au côté gauche de l' | * **x** : position du point par rapport au côté gauche de l' | ||
* **y** : position du point par rapport au dessus de l' | * **y** : position du point par rapport au dessus de l' | ||
- | * **w** : largeur (du mot Width). | + | * **w** : largeur (Width). |
- | * **h** : hauteur (du mot Height). | + | * **h** : hauteur (Height). |
- | * **c** : couleur (1=point allumé, 0=point éteint) | + | * **c** : couleur (1 = point allumé, 0 = point éteint) |
{{ : | {{ : | ||
Ligne 64: | Ligne 65: | ||
</ | </ | ||
- | //Exemple : "Hello World"// | + | //Exemple : "Hello World"// |
+ | {{ : | ||
<code cpp helloWorld.cpp> | <code cpp helloWorld.cpp> | ||
// Exemple d' | // Exemple d' | ||
// Description : Affiche " | // Description : Affiche " | ||
- | #include " | + | #include " |
#include " | #include " | ||
#include " | #include " | ||
Ligne 76: | Ligne 78: | ||
void setup() { | void setup() { | ||
+ | // Initialisation | ||
Serial.begin(115200); | Serial.begin(115200); | ||
oled.begin(); | oled.begin(); | ||
+ | |||
+ | // Cofiguration de l' | ||
oled.setTextSize(1); | oled.setTextSize(1); | ||
oled.setTextColor(1); | oled.setTextColor(1); | ||
oled.setCursor(0, | oled.setCursor(0, | ||
- | oled.println(" | + | oled.println(" |
- | oled.display(); | + | oled.display(); |
} | } | ||